diff --git a/apps/remix/app/components/general/direct-template/direct-template-signing-form.tsx b/apps/remix/app/components/general/direct-template/direct-template-signing-form.tsx
index 46bbcb1a8..5483e051d 100644
--- a/apps/remix/app/components/general/direct-template/direct-template-signing-form.tsx
+++ b/apps/remix/app/components/general/direct-template/direct-template-signing-form.tsx
@@ -190,6 +190,7 @@ export const DirectTemplateSigningForm = ({
field={field}
onSignField={onSignField}
onUnsignField={onUnsignField}
+ typedSignatureEnabled={template.templateMeta?.typedSignatureEnabled}
/>
))
.with(FieldType.INITIALS, () => (
@@ -343,6 +344,7 @@ export const DirectTemplateSigningForm = ({
onChange={(value) => {
setSignature(value);
}}
+ allowTypedSignature={template.templateMeta?.typedSignatureEnabled}
/>
diff --git a/apps/remix/app/components/general/document-signing/document-signing-page-view.tsx b/apps/remix/app/components/general/document-signing/document-signing-page-view.tsx
index 2ef032e6f..22787592d 100644
--- a/apps/remix/app/components/general/document-signing/document-signing-page-view.tsx
+++ b/apps/remix/app/components/general/document-signing/document-signing-page-view.tsx
@@ -178,7 +178,11 @@ export const DocumentSigningPageView = ({
.map((field) =>
match(field.type)
.with(FieldType.SIGNATURE, () => (
-
+
))
.with(FieldType.INITIALS, () => (